A humorous commentary on the legendary thriftiness of Cavan men

lyrics

There's beautiful country up around Kilnaleck,

But the smell of the compost

Would make your dog sick

It hangs in the air

And perfumes your clothes

For a tenner they’ll rent you a peg for your nose

I tell ya hai!... It’s for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or



In Ballyjamesduff on the hill you will find

They’ve erected a rather large wind turbine

Hoping the light bill is easier paid

As the height of this yoke

Is a terror to see

I tell ya hai!... it’s for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or


Up In Cavan town a protest did start

Against Irish water

and their water charge

The sergeant out of the window remarked

we’ll start a collection

and scatter the march

I tell ya hai!... itst’s for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ean cavan hoor


Now the Cavan shopkeeper’s

We’ve heard of before

He charge you a toll

For crossing the door

But anything goes

With a schilling to make

He’d sell you cat shite

And call it sweet cake

I tell ya hai!... it's for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or



Now christmas in cavan’s

A terrible pass

The auld fella’d take you down

To the church yard

Not to pray for the dead

Their souls for to save

But to show the poor childeren

Santa Claus’s grave

I tell ya hai!... it’s for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or


On a Sunday a good Cavan man goes to mass

The priest on the altar

A chalice he’ll pass

Along the front row

The faithful to find

But they’re not even christian

They want the free wine

I tell ya hai!... itst’s for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or




Down in Virginia

on the border with Meath

The locals are all a peculiar breed

but with the Jones’s

They cannot keep up

Because all They want

Is the Sam Maguire cup

I tell ya hai!... it's for sure

There’s no one as cute as a mean Cavan hoor

And none are as cute as a mean Cavan hoor
